要成为一名CC程序员,你需要遵循以下步骤:
学习C语言
从基础语法开始,掌握变量、数据类型、运算符、控制结构(如if语句、switch语句、循环语句等)、函数和指针等基本概念。
使用经典的教材如《C程序设计语言》(The C Programming Language)进行学习,并结合在线课程和编程练习网站如LeetCode、HackerRank等进行实践。
深入理解指针和内存管理,因为C语言中指针的概念非常重要,且需要手动管理内存。
了解嵌入式系统
学习嵌入式系统的基础知识,了解其应用领域,如汽车电子、家电、工业控制等。
掌握一些常用的嵌入式硬件和软件平台,例如ARM Cortex、STM32等微控制器。
积累项目经验
通过实际项目来应用你所学的C语言和嵌入式系统知识,这有助于你更好地理解理论知识并提高编程能力。
参与开源项目或自己发起个人项目,不断锻炼自己的编程和问题解决能力。
持续学习新技术
软件行业技术更新迅速,持续学习新技术对于成为一名优秀的程序员至关重要。
关注行业动态,学习新的编程语言、框架和工具,保持自己的知识储备和竞争力。
培养良好的编程习惯
学习并遵循代码规范,编写可读性强、可维护的代码。
多动手实践,少看书,注重编程思想的培养。
勤练习,学完新的知识点后要及时应用,避免遗忘。
建立个人品牌
在GitHub、博客、论坛等平台上分享你的学习成果和项目经验,建立个人品牌。
参与技术社区,与其他程序员交流,扩大自己的视野和影响力。
通过以上步骤,你可以逐步成为一名具备扎实C/C++编程基础和嵌入式系统知识的CC程序员。记住,持续学习和实践是成功的关键。